The National Monuments Service's description
On a SE-facing slope in pastureland. This children's burial ground is defined by a subrectangular platform (13m NE-SW; 12m NW-SE) which is overgrown with bushes and nettles. Small set stones mark graves. (O'Flanagan 1927, II, 211)
